Paul Pogba's agent Mino Raiola hits back at Paul Scholes over the Manchester United legend's criticism of his client.

Paul Pogba's agent Mino Raiola has launched a scathing attack on Paul Scholes following the Manchester United legend's criticism of his client.

Scholes slammed Pogba's inconsistency and lack of leadership in the wake of United's 3-2 defeat to Brighton & Hove Albion on Sunday, while also claiming that the Frenchman's post-match admission that he went into the game with the wrong attitude was indefensible.

However, Raiola has hit back at the 11-time Premier League winner, sarcastically suggesting that Scholes should advise chief executive Ed Woodward to sell Pogba.

"Some people need to talk for fear of being forgotten. Paul Scholes wouldn't recognize a leader if he was in front of Sir Winston Churchill," Raiola wrote on Twitter.

"Paul Scholes should become sports director and advise Woodward to sell Pogba. Would be sleepless nights to find Pogba a new club."

Pogba's future at Old Trafford has once again come under scrutiny recently following reports of a fresh fallout with manager Jose Mourinho.
